12 AAC 06.040 - License to wrestle

(a) To qualify for a license as a professional wrestler an applicant must submit
(1) an application on a form provided by the commission;
(2) the fees required by AS 05.10.120; and
(3) an official copy of the applicant's birth certificate verifying that the applicant is at least 18 years of age.
(b) An applicant over the age of 54 years will not be granted a license to wrestle or have a license renewed, unless special consideration is given by the commission to the applicant's physical condition.
(c) The commission will, in its discretion, order the examination of any wrestler at any time for the purpose of determination whether the wrestler is fit and qualified to engage in further matches.
